Description

In a world overwhelmed by misinformation, two experts come together to create a practical handbook aimed at helping individuals navigate and counter false claims. With a focus on cognitive psychology and effective communication strategies, this resource offers valuable insights on how to address misconceptions and promote critical thinking.

Readers will discover techniques for recognizing false narratives and underlying biases that often perpetuate misinformation. The authors emphasize the importance of clear, concise messaging in dispelling myths, providing readers with tools to engage in constructive dialogues with others.

Through engaging examples and evidence-based strategies, the handbook serves not just as an academic reference, but also as a user-friendly guide for anyone passionate about fostering a well-informed society. Its accessibility makes it an essential contribution to the ongoing fight against misinformation in today's digital age.
